Sonographer Work Description<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"HesperusThere are more than one acceptable titles for ultrasound techs (technicians). They are also called sonogram techs, diagnostic medical sonographers (or just sonographers) and ultrasound technologists. Regardless of name, they all have the same basic job function, which is to implement diagnostic ultrasound testing on patients. While many practice as generalists there are specializations within the field, for instance in cardiology and pediatrics.
